Revision as of 19:29, 23 August 2010
- A man shoots dead nine people, including himself, after taking hostages on board a bus in Manila, Philippines.
- Kenyan runner David Lekuta Rudisha (pictured) breaks a 13-year-old world record in the 800 metres at the ISTAF IAAF World Challenge in Berlin.
- A federal election is held in Australia, with results indicating a hung parliament with neither the incumbent Labor Party nor the Liberal/National Coalition able to form a majority government.
- Iran begins loading fuel into its first nuclear power plant in Bushehr, preparing it to begin producing electricity.
- Bolivia declares a state of emergency as forest fires rage across 15,000 square kilometers (5,800 sq mi).
